Ramirez, who homered in the bottom of the first to put the the Flashes ahead, had three hits on the night, to go with his four RBI's. His second homer, a 3-run shot off of Ruddy Lugo in the eighth, gave the Flashes some breathing room after they had taken a one run lead.Bronson Arroyo wasn't as sharp as he would have liked, allowing five runs in 6 innings, including a solo homer to Raul Ibanez and a 3-run shot to Stan Musial.
His opponent, Ervin Santana, was better, allowing just 2 runs in 6 innings and departed with a 5-2 lead, but the normally stingy Ybor City Rollers bullpen allowed the Flashes back into the game. B.J. Ryan allowed 3 runs in the seventh on a Rich Aurilia homerun to tie the game, and Lugo allowed homers to Michael Barrett and Ramirez to take the loss.
